What companies run services between Barton on Sea and Isle of Wight, England?
There is no direct connection from Barton on Sea to Isle of Wight. However, you can take the train to Brockenhurst, take the train to Lymington Pier, walk to Lymington, take the ferry to Yarmouth, walk to Bus Station, then take the line 7 bus to The Waverley.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Green Lane to The Waverley via Station Street, Lymington Town, Lymington Pier, Lymington, Yarmouth, and Bus Station in around 3h 7m.
